A PAIR OF JAMES II SILVER TOILET BOXES
MARK OF ANTHONY NELME, LONDON, 1686
A PAIR OF JAMES II SILVER TOILET BOXES MARK OF ANTHONY NELME, LONDON, 1686 Each square, with canted corners, the sides and cover with matte punched panels, the cover engraved with coat-of-arms within plumed mantling, each marked on interior base of box, the covers apparently unmarked 3¼ in. (8 cm.) long; 9 oz. 10 dwt. (299 gr.) (2)
